无忧启动论坛

标题: 求助用win7非精简版坛友帮测:普通用户使用管理员身份运行powershell能否实现? [打印本页]

作者: 2013kyj    时间: 昨天 11:44
标题: 求助用win7非精简版坛友帮测:普通用户使用管理员身份运行powershell能否实现?
本帖最后由 2013kyj 于 2026-3-8 12:22 编辑

我正使用的是极限精简版win7系统
我想在win7下的普通用户帐户下使用管理员身份运行powershell:
尝试过ctrl+shift+回车, 也试过直接选择"用管理员身份运行powershell", 都不灵, 成功的话,powershell命令行窗口的标题栏上应该有“管理员”字样

按理说正常应该会弹出管理员认证的对话框吗?


所以, 求助用win7非精简版坛友帮测:普通用户使用管理员身份运行powershell能否实现?

作者: a66    时间: 昨天 12:28
不用Win7 精简版
作者: l3429900    时间: 昨天 12:29
已经不用win7,帮顶
作者: nttwqz    时间: 昨天 12:31
用精简版,纯碎自己找虐。。。

微软有个软件叫procmon,可以监测程序的文件、注册表、网络、进程和线程等等。
作者: 门口    时间: 昨天 13:03
这和powershell有什么关系?看你的说法右键任何命令都没有或看不出是管理员权限吧。
作者: 2013kyj    时间: 昨天 13:03
nttwqz 发表于 2026-3-8 12:31
用精简版,纯碎自己找虐。。。

微软有个软件叫procmon,可以监测程序的文件、注册表、网络、进程和线程 ...

确实有点纯碎自己找虐
作者: guong    时间: 昨天 13:14
不是win7系统 帮不上
作者: 地球守护者    时间: 昨天 13:29
好像前面已经说明,Windows PS,只是Windows 8以此上面,可以正常使用,不是Windows 8、Windows 8.1、Windows 10、Windows 11,怎么可以能够使用,除了使用PS(不是Windows PS)
作者: 奇游加速器有毒    时间: 昨天 14:05
不能吧
作者: fengge2018    时间: 昨天 14:30
普通用户是指用非管理员用户吧?那应该不行吧,这和精简版甚至和win7没啥关系吧,win10也一样
作者: it323    时间: 昨天 15:29
极限精简麻烦永远在路上,今天处理好明天继续。
作者: yyz2191958    时间: 昨天 17:58
估计难
作者: ebaqiang    时间: 昨天 18:29
这还真不懂,哪位大佬来讲讲
作者: lbw2007    时间: 昨天 20:58
精简版不知道,但是我知道powershell可以给自己提权?
作者: gah99sw    时间: 昨天 21:13
本帖最后由 gah99sw 于 2026-3-8 21:31 编辑

Adminitrator用户--附件-- powershell  不能右键-以管理员身份,加注册表也不行。直接运行后,就是管理员了,版本是2.0的。Get-Host | Select-Object Version只能用这个命令,其它的报错。.NET版本是4    4.5    4.5.1   4.5.2  4.6  4.7.2。我以前WIN7  64位,用 4.8 升级PSH到5.1  7.2.23,功能当然不能和WIN10相比 。就是一个编程框架环境。PS2.0 PS5.1 PS7.2.1   Windows Registry Editor Version 5.00

[HKEY_CLASSES_ROOT\Directory\Background\shell\Windows.PowershellAsAdmin]
"CanonicalName"="{ADB73FFC-1568-4D7D-BCD5-6D11A417AF64}"
"CommandStateSync"=""
"Description"="@shell32.dll,-37449"
"ExplorerCommandHandler"="{BF0AC53F-D51C-419F-92E3-2298E125F004}"
"Icon"="imageres.dll,-5373"
"ImpliedSelectionModel"=dword:00000001
"MUIVerb"="@shell32.dll,-37448"
"ResolveLinksInvokeBehavior"=dword:00000003
"ResolveLinksQueryBehavior"=dword:00000000


[HKEY_CLASSES_ROOT\Directory\Background\shell\RunAs]
@="@shell32.dll,-8506"
"Description"="@shell32.dll,-37445"
"Icon"="imageres.dll,-5324"
"MUIVerb"="@shell32.dll,-37444"
"NoWorkingDirectory"=""


[HKEY_CLASSES_ROOT\Directory\Background\shell\RunAs\command]
@="cmd.exe /s /k pushd \"%V\""

作者: gah99sw    时间: 昨天 21:34
本帖最后由 gah99sw 于 2026-3-9 08:21 编辑

,安装 .Net Framework 4.5 或更高版本    4.7.2  4.8  都行。
最后,下载PowerShell5.1补丁,里面有三个.cab补丁 。集成到系统中。命令如下:
  比如3个CAB放在文件夹 D:\powershell7.2  里面
dism  /online  /add-package  /packagepath:d:\PowerShell7.2\1.Windows6.1-KB2809215-x64.cab
dism  /online  /add-package  /packagepath:d:\PowerShell7.2\2.Windows6.1-KB2872035-x64.cab
dism  /online  /add-package  /packagepath:d:\PowerShell7.2\3.Windows6.1-KB3191566-x64.cab

批处理执行最方便,不用一个一个字符敲 这种集成方法会保留二个版本。github.com/PowerShell   7.2.23   

######
到微软公司去 WIN7  64 对应的 PowerShell 升级包   [从2.0  到  5.1]
id=54616
自动更新要打开,它会一个高版本换一个低版本。




欢迎光临 无忧启动论坛 (http://bbs.c3.wuyou.net/) Powered by Discuz! X3.3